The W2K trail is part of the Whakaipo Section of the Great Lake Trails. It provides great views across Lake Taupo and back down towards Kinloch, one of the most beautiful lakeside villages in the country.

Lava Glass is the playground of Lynden Over, one of New Zealand's leading glass artists. In his studio, you get the opportunity to watch him and resident artists at work. Lava Glass is the first certified net carbon zero glass studio in the world.
